The mind has learned to defend itself from the fragility of life through craving, anger, fear, and fantasy. How do we come to trust the deeper security provided by love and wisdom without demonizing the challenging patterns we encounter so often in our hearts? Join Michele and Jesse for a meditation retreat where we will explore these dynamics and attempt to instill a sense of confidence in our path going forward – in the many fruitful ways that are possible. We will be online together for half the day and recorded instructions will be provided for those wanting to make it a full day of practice. All are welcome!

Michele McDonald
Michele McDonald has taught Insight meditation since 1982 and teaches extensively throughout the United States, Canada, Burma, and various locations around the world. Jesse Maceo Vega-Frey's teaching aims to inspire the skills, determination, and faith necessary to realize the deepest human freedom. He is a student of Michele McDonald and his approach is rooted in the tradition of Mahasi Sayadaw of Burma.
